Dept Of Defense- Dept Of The Army- Ngb- W7Rq Uspfo Activity Vi Arng

Virgin Islands National Guard Family Programs Volunteer Workshop - The contractor shall provide a conference package to include lodging, meals, and conference space co- located in the same location necessary to effectively conduct the Virgin Islands National Guard ( VING) State Family Program ( SFP) Annual Volunteer

Conference package including lodging, meals, and conference space for a volunteer workshop. Conference package for Virgin Islands National Guard State Family Program Annual Volunteer Workshop FY2026, to include lodging, meals, and conference space for up to 48 volunteers for 3 days on St. Croix, USVI. Specifics include: conference room divisible into two breakout rooms, audiovisual services, 14 single occupancy lodging rooms, 2 double occupancy lodging rooms, breakfast for 18 on Saturday and Sunday, lunch for 48 on Saturday and Sunday, dinner for 48 on Saturday, vegetarian meal option, morning and afternoon refreshments on Saturday and Sunday, and drinks with all meals.
